WebReal property can be transferred in many different ways, both voluntarily and involuntarily. There are three ways you can voluntarily transfer or grant an interest in real property while you are living: by sale, gift or dedication. In a sale, you transfer your property in exchange for something else of value, called “consideration.”.

Adding a family member to the deed as a joint owner for no consideration is considered a gift of 50% of the property’s fair market value for tax purposes. If the value of the gift exceeds the annual exclusion limit ($16,000 for 2024) the donor will need to file a gift tax return (via Form 709) to report the transfer.
